Hilton is a village and civil parish in the South Derbyshire district of Derbyshire, England. The population at the 2021 Census (including Marston on Dove) was 8,266.

History

Hilton was mentioned in the Domesday Book in 1086 as belonging to Henry de Ferrers and being worth ten shillings. It was later held by Dale Abbey. After the dissolution of the monasteries, the manor passed to the Earl of Chesterfield, and later to the Every baronets. Wakelyn Hall is a Grade II listed half-timbered building dating back to the 16th century. Mary, Queen of Scots allegedly stopped at Wakelyn Hall briefly on her way to imprisonment at Tutbury Castle. Other historic buildings include the Old Talbot Inn, the Wesleyan Chapel and Hilton Lodge. Hilton was the birthplace of Herbert Massey who authorised the Great Escape.
